Emergency Plan Revision Approved for Canical Fuel Storage Park
The Regional Secretariat for Health and Civil Protection has approved the revision of the Emergency Plan for the Industrial Free Trade Zone and the Canical Fuel Storage Park.
Order no. 197/2026 formalizes the revision of the Industrial Free Trade Zone Emergency Plan, which also serves as the External Emergency Plan for the Canical Fuel Storage Park. This measure is part of the prevention regime for major accidents involving dangerous substances, in accordance with Decree-Law no. 150/2015. The plan is available for consultation on the Madeira Development Society, S.A. website.
